Counselling Service Coordinator (Maternity cover)


The Role

Turning Tides operates a small-scale volunteer counselling service, offering a responsive, professional, and accessible pathway to therapeutic support for individuals experiencing homelessness. Recognising the significant barriers and health inequalities faced by those experiencing multiple and compound needs, the service plays a crucial role in fostering sustainable change. Clients consistently highlight the safe and supportive space it provides, enabling them to explore their experiences, develop essential self-management tools, and build more stable, fulfilling lives.

This role is fixed term for one year.


About You

We are seeking a dedicated Counselling Coordinator who is passionate about supporting individuals affected by homelessness and committed to ensuring fair access to therapeutic care. This role is responsible for the day-to-day management and strategic development of the counselling service, ensuring it aligns with the British Association for Counselling and Psychotherapy (BACP) ethical standards and Turning Tides’ trauma-informed approach.

This is an opportunity to lead and shape a vital counselling service that fosters healing, resilience, and long-term change for individuals experiencing homelessness. By ensuring ethical, high-quality, and accessible support, the Counselling Coordinator will play a key role in empowering individuals to take control of their futures.

Millions of people in England are only one pay cheque away from being homeless.

Turning Tides have provided support to thousands of local men and women in West Sussex for almost 30 years.

We provide a warm, safe space to listen to anyone who comes to us for help. Our support services empower people to find the strength and belief in themselves to create a brighter future.

Together we can make a difference and end homelessness where you live.
